在发邮件时需要设置smtp协议,请问如何在vb实现?
谢谢告我!!!!!!!! 问题点数:0、回复次数:4Top
1 楼egxsun(egxsun)回复于 2004-11-01 19:18:09 得分 0
upTop
2 楼danielrh()回复于 2004-11-01 19:27:52 得分 0
Example:
Private Sub SendMail(strInv As String, strFile As String)
Dim strSender As String, objMail As New jmail.SMTPMail
Dim strSubject As String
strSubject = strInv & " XML File"
strSender = Nz(DLookup("IntEmail", "logList", "logName='" & Forms("frmlogin").txtUserID & "'"), "")
If Len(Trim(strSender)) = 0 Then
strSender = "logistics@foxconn.com"
MsgBox "由于您沒有Internet Email地址,您將不能收到XML文件的抄本." & vbNewLine & "請到cmm logistics信箱查看.", vbInformation
End If
With objMail
.ServerAddress = "10.150.100.102:25"
.Logging = True
.Silent = True
.Charset = "Big5"
.Sender = strSender
.ReplyTo = strSender
.ClearRecipients
.AddRecipient strSender
.Subject = strSubject
.AddRecipient "mdobos@cz.foxconn.com"
.AddRecipient "foxdata2@foxconn.cz"
.AddRecipient "jirimuller@foxconn.cz"
.ClearAttachments
.AddAttachment strFile
.Execute
End With
Set objMail = Nothing
End SubTop
3 楼aijie099(罗漫年华)回复于 2004-11-01 20:44:06 得分 0
你用的是那种方式发邮件,如果你用apimTop
4 楼xiaohuangtao(绿毛网虫)回复于 2004-11-12 17:54:41 得分 0
http://www.smartmaildemo.comTop




